Understanding Wheel Alignment in Racing

Earlier than delving into the role of wheel alignment plates, it’s essential to understand why alignment is so essential in racing. Wheel alignment refers back to the adjustment of a automotive’s suspension, which includes setting the angles of the wheels so that they are within the correct positions relative to each other and the road. There are three primary alignment angles: camber, toe, and caster.

Camber is the angle of the wheels when viewed from the front of the car. Negative camber, the place the top of the tire tilts inward, is frequent in racing as it permits better tire contact during cornering.

Toe refers to the direction in which the tires are pointed relative to the centerline of the vehicle. A slight toe-in or toe-out can improve stability or turn-in responsiveness.

Caster is the angle of the steering pivot when considered from the side of the automotive, affecting stability and steering effort.

In racing, these alignment angles have to be precisely adjusted based on track conditions, driving style, and vehicle setup. Proper alignment ensures that the tires wear evenly, preserve maximum traction, and provide the motive force with higher control. Misalignment, then again, can lead to poor dealing with, reduced speed, and uneven tire wear, all of which are detrimental in a race setting.

What Are Wheel Alignment Plates?

Wheel alignment plates are specialized tools designed to simplify the process of aligning a vehicle’s wheels. These plates are typically made from lightweight but durable materials like aluminum and have smooth surfaces to allow easy movement of the wheels throughout alignment. The plates are positioned under the tires, and with the help of measurement units, similar to toe gauges and camber gauges, the angles of the wheels can be adjusted exactly without the necessity for complicated machinery.

Unlike traditional alignment methods, which typically require a full lift and a professional alignment machine, wheel alignment plates provide a more arms-on approach. They permit race teams to perform quick and exact adjustments trackside, making them a valuable tool in motorsports. This convenience is especially critical in racing, the place conditions can change rapidly, and adjustments must be made on the fly to keep up competitive performance.

2. Customization to Track Conditions

Every race track is totally different, with varying levels of grip, surface quality, and cornering dynamics. Wheel alignment plates permit teams to tailor the automobile’s setas much as the precise calls for of each track. As an example, a track with tight corners may require more aggressive camber settings for higher cornering grip, while a high-speed circuit may necessitate adjustments to toe settings for greater straight-line stability. With wheel alignment plates, these adjustments can be made swiftly and accurately, ensuring the car is always optimized for peak performance.
